Mutual funds have become one of the most structured and accessible ways for Nigerians to participate in the financial markets. They offer professional management, diversification, and flexibility, making them suitable for both new and experienced investors.
However, while mutual funds simplify investing, selecting the right one still requires careful thought. Beyond projected returns, investors must consider how a fund aligns with their financial goals, risk appetite, and liquidity needs.
Before committing your capital, here are five key considerations.
Clearly Define Your Investment Goal
Every investment decision should begin with clarity of purpose.
Ask yourself what you are trying to achieve. Are you investing to:
- Preserve capital?
- Generate regular income?
- Achieve long-term growth?
- Save toward a specific financial goal?
Different mutual funds are structured to serve different objectives.
For instance:
- Money market funds typically focus on capital preservation and liquidity.
- Equity funds are designed for long-term capital appreciation.
Your investment objective should guide your choice of fund—not market trends or popular opinion.
Understand Your Risk Tolerance
Risk and return are closely connected.
Equity-based mutual funds, for example, may experience short-term price fluctuations due to market volatility. Investors with a longer investment horizon are often better positioned to tolerate these movements in pursuit of higher returns.
Conservative funds such as money market funds generally offer more stability, though with comparatively moderate returns.
To better understand your risk tolerance, consider:
- How comfortable am I with short-term declines?
- How long can I leave this investment untouched?
- Would market volatility cause me to withdraw prematurely?
Being honest about your risk tolerance is critical to staying invested through market cycles.
Assess the Fund’s Track Record and Strategy
While past performance does not guarantee future results, it can provide insight into how a fund has navigated different market environments.
When evaluating a fund, consider:
- Performance across multiple time horizons
- Consistency, rather than just peak returns
- The fund’s stated investment strategy
- Asset allocation and portfolio composition
A well-managed fund typically demonstrates discipline, adaptability, and alignment with its investment mandate.
Pay Attention to Fees and Net Returns
Fees may appear small, but over time they compound and can significantly impact overall returns.
It is important to understand:
- Management fees
- Administrative costs
- Entry or exit charges, if applicable
Ultimately, investors should focus on net returns after fees, as this reflects the true growth of their investment.
Transparency around costs is often a strong indicator of a well-structured and professionally managed fund.
Consider Liquidity and Access
Liquidity refers to how easily you can access your funds when needed.
Some mutual funds allow relatively quick withdrawals, while others may require longer processing times. If the funds being invested may be needed in the short term, liquidity becomes an important factor in your decision.
As a general rule, emergency funds should not be exposed to products with significant market risk or limited accessibility.
